From: oetiker Date: Sun, 26 Dec 2010 16:04:03 +0000 (+0000) Subject: make MAP_PRIVATE conditional on AIX not being defined ... should fix part of #216 X-Git-Url: https://git.octo.it/?p=rrdtool.git;a=commitdiff_plain;h=9d7aa8ddae065b774fe4eb1df76a3242b9db2d53;hp=c597537ef581c7281a0ee75f712778dddd1d6929 make MAP_PRIVATE conditional on AIX not being defined ... should fix part of #216 git-svn-id: svn://svn.oetiker.ch/rrdtool/trunk/program@2157 a5681a0c-68f1-0310-ab6d-d61299d08faa --- diff --git a/src/rrd_open.c b/src/rrd_open.c index 78d5174..5f3723f 100644 --- a/src/rrd_open.c +++ b/src/rrd_open.c @@ -158,7 +158,9 @@ rrd_file_t *rrd_open( if (rdwr & RRD_READONLY) { flags |= O_RDONLY; #ifdef HAVE_MMAP +# if !defined(AIX) rrd_simple_file->mm_flags = MAP_PRIVATE; +# endif # ifdef MAP_NORESERVE rrd_simple_file->mm_flags |= MAP_NORESERVE; /* readonly, so no swap backing needed */ # endif